Cetane Associates adds two analysts to M&A team
Cetane Associates welcomed Jack McMurchie and Taylor Garnett as analysts in its financial advisory firm. They both provide support to Cetane’s mergers and acquisitions deal execution team.

Before joining Cetane, McMurchie spent three years at Turner Stone & Co. as an audit professional, leading and supporting engagements for both SEC-registered and privately held clients. His work included analyzing financial statements, testing internal controls and ensuring compliance with accounting standards and regulations. He holds a Bachelor of Business Administration in accounting and finance from the University of Oklahoma.

Garnett has over three years of experience in commercial banking, specializing in financial services for health care and not-for-profit organizations. Before joining Cetane, she was an associate at Texas-based Amegy Bank, where she supported financing for a wide range of clients, including churches, nonprofits, private schools, arts organizations and health care institutions. Taylor holds a bachelor’s degree in finance from Texas A&M University.
“As Cetane continues to expand across the home and commercial services sectors, bringing on professionals like Jack and Taylor is essential to sustaining our momentum,” says Barrett Conway, managing director and principal of Cetane. “Their financial expertise and strong work ethic enhance our ability to serve clients nationwide.”
Cetane is a leading provider of financial advisory services to business owners in the propane, heating oil, pest control, lawn care, landscaping and HVAC and plumbing industries. Clients engage Cetane to advise on sales, spin-offs and acquisitions, as well as to perform valuation and ad hoc corporate finance assignments.
